One of the most iconic trails of La Pedriza that takes you from the top of Las Zetas de La Pedriza fireroad to the Cantocochino car parking.

It runs inside a dense pine forest and this third section is mainly fast and flowy with roots and some natural jumps and easy rock gardens.

Access Info

Trough Las Zetas de la Pedriza access road

Disclaimer

Be careful with the hikers as it's a very busy trail mainly on weekends
